WebThe concentrations of very dilute solutions are often expressed in parts per million ( ppm ), which is grams of solute per 10 6 g of solution, or in parts per billion ( ppb ), which is grams of solute per 10 9 g of solution. For aqueous solutions at 20°C, 1 ppm corresponds to 1 μg per milliliter, and 1 ppb corresponds to 1 ng per milliliter. WebDilute Solution of Known Molarity. WebMay 17, 2024 · Definition of green chemistry. Green chemistry is the design of chemical products and processes that reduce or eliminate the use or generation of hazardous substances. Green chemistry applies across the life cycle of a chemical product, including its design, manufacture, use, and ultimate disposal.
